Nursing home jobs in Memphis, TN are in high demand due to the city’s aging population. As the baby boomer generation ages and many members of their family move away, the need for experienced and qualified nursing home staff increases. In Memphis, it is estimated that about one in five people is over the age of 65. With such a large senior population, nursing homes in Memphis offer a variety of jobs and career opportunities. Nursing home jobs in Memphis can range from direct care positions such as nursing assistants and patient care technicians, to administrative positions such as activity coordinators, dietary aides, and social workers. Most nursing homes in Memphis require applicants to have at least a high school diploma or GED, and some may require certification. For those individuals interested in a career in nursing, Memphis has several colleges and universities that offer nursing degrees and certificates. The job market for nursing home jobs in Memphis is competitive, so applicants should be prepared to demonstrate their skills and experience. Applicants should also be aware of the regulations and laws that govern nursing homes in Tennessee. In addition to completing necessary training, applicants must also pass a background check and have the ability to provide quality care and service to residents. Salaries vary depending on the position and the experience of the applicant. In general, entry-level positions pay an average of $10.00 an hour and increase with experience. For those who have experience in the field and have obtained advanced certifications, salaries may increase to around $20.00 an hour. Stockbroking Jobs in Australia: A Comprehensive Guide Stockbroking is an exciting and dynamic industry that involves buying and selling stocks, shares, and other financial instruments on behalf of clients. It is an essential part of the global financial market, and Australia is no exception. The Australian stock market is one of the most vibrant and robust in the world, making it an ideal place for stockbrokers to work and thrive. If you are considering a career in stockbroking, it is essential to understand what the industry entails, the qualifications and skills required, the job prospects, and the salary expectations. This article provides a comprehensive guide to stockbroking jobs in Australia, including an overview of the industry, the qualifications and skills required, the job prospects, and the salary expectations. Overview of the Stockbroking Industry in Australia The stockbroking industry in Australia is regulated by the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C), which oversees the conduct of brokers and ensures that they comply with the relevant laws and regulations. There are over 200 stockbroking firms in Australia, ranging from large multinational corporations to small boutique firms. Some of the major players in the industry include Commonwealth Bank, Macquarie Group, and Morgan Stanley. The Australian stock market is divided into two main exchanges: the Australian Securities Exchange (ASX) and the National Stock Exchange of Australia (NSX). The ASX is the primary exchange and is where the majority of stocks and shares are traded. The NSX is a smaller exchange that primarily focuses on small-cap stocks and emerging companies. Qualifications and Skills Required for Stockbroking Jobs in Australia To work as a stockbroker in Australia, you must have the necessary qualifications and skills. The minimum requirement is a b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, economics, or a related field. However, many employers prefer candidates with a postgraduate degree, such as a Master of Business Administration (MBA) or a Master of Applied Finance (MAF). In addition to formal education, stockbrokers must have exc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, as well as strong communication and interpersonal skills. They must be able to work well under pressure and have a high level of attention to detail. They must also be comfortable working with numbers and have a good understanding of financial markets and economic trends. Job Prospects for Stockbroking Jobs in Australia The job prospects for stockbrokers in Australia are generally positive, with a growing demand for skilled professionals in the industry. According to the Australian Government's Job Outlook website, the number of stockbrokers in Australia is expected to grow moderately over the next five years. This growth is due to the increasing demand for financial services and the growing complexity of the financial markets. Stockbrokers can work in a variety of roles, including as advisors to individual clients, as traders for investment banks or other financial institutions, or as analysts for research firms. They can also work in different sectors, such as equities, derivatives, or fixed income. Salary Expectations for Stockbroking Jobs in Australia The salary expectations for stockbroking jobs in Australia vary depending on the experience, qualifications, and skills of the individual. According to PayScale, the average salary for a stockbroker in Australia is around AUD 85,000 per year. However, this can vary greatly depending on the employer, the location, and the sector in which the stockbroker works. Entry-level stockbrokers can expect to earn around AUD 50,000 to AUD 70,000 per year, while experienced stockbrokers can earn upwards of AUD 150,000 per year. Some of the highest-paying stockbroking jobs in Australia are in investment banking, where experienced professionals can earn salaries of over AUD 300,000 per year. Real estate appraisal jobs in the Bay Area have seen a significant increase in demand over the past few years, as the region's housing market continues to grow and evolve. With a booming tech industry and a high cost of living, the Bay Area is a unique and highly competitive market for real estate appraisers, requiring specialized knowledge and skills to succeed. As of 2021, the average salary for a real estate appraiser in the Bay Area is around $90,000 per year, with many experienced appraisers earning well over six figures. However, the job market can be highly competitive, and it may take some time to build a successful career in the field. To become a real estate appraiser in California, you must complete a set of education and experience requirements set by the state. These requirements include a minimum of 150 hours of coursework, including 15 hours of USPAP (Uniform Standards of Professional Appraisal Practice) training, as well as several years of supervised experience under a licensed appraiser. Once you have completed these requirements, you must pass a state exam to become a licensed appraiser. You can then further your career by pursuing additional education and certification, such as becoming a Certified Residential Appraiser or Certified General Appraiser, which can open up higher-paying job opportunities. The job of a real estate appraiser involves evaluating and determining the value of properties, including residential, commercial, and industrial properties. Appraisers use a variety of methods to determine value, including market analysis, property inspections, and data analysis. In the Bay Area, real estate appraisers must have a deep understanding of the local market, as well as the various factors that can affect property values, such as zoning and land use regulations, environmental issues, and the overall economic climate. One of the biggest challenges facing real estate appraisers in the Bay Area is the high cost of living, which can make it difficult to attract and retain talent. Many appraisers have turned to freelance work or starting their own appraisal businesses to take advantage of the demand for their services while avoiding the high costs of living and working in the city. However, with the steady growth of the Bay Area's real estate market, there is a growing need for skilled and experienced appraisers to help evaluate and determine the true value of properties across the region.
